Prosecution complaint filed against Virbhadra Singh

ANI  |  New Delhi [India] 

The on Thursday filed prosecution complaint against former Himachal Pradesh and five others, in a case.

Earlier in the day, the probe agency filed a supplementary charge sheet against Singh, his wife and others under the provisions of the Prevention of Act (PMLA).

In January 22, the agency had filed a status report in connection with the case.

Singh had allegedly accumulated assets worth Rs 6.03 crore in his name and in the names of his family members, which were disproportionate to his known sources of income, during his tenure as the from 2009 to 2011.
